Travel Medical Surgical Nurse Salary Guide: Missouri
Average Travel Medical Surgical Nurse Salary
Average Travel Medical Surgical Nurse Salary
$2,048/week
The average salary for a Travel Medical Surgical Nurse in Missouri is $2,048 per week. This is 2% lower than the US average of $2,094.
Last updated on July 4, 2026. Based on 1,137 active jobs on Vivian.com in the last 7 days.

What cities in Missouri pay the most for Travel Med Surg Nurses?
What cities in Missouri pay the most for Travel Med Surg Nurses?
| City | Average Weekly Salary | Max Weekly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Columbia, Missouri | $2,223 | $2,977 |
| Liberty, Missouri | $2,197 | $2,545 |
